Split user-turn-stop into inference-triggered and finalized events

Fixes a real bug: with `filter_incomplete_user_turns` enabled, the
smart-turn detector's tentative stop was firing `on_user_turn_stopped`
before the LLM had a chance to veto it. Observers, transcript
appenders and UI indicators received an early — and sometimes
duplicated — signal.

Decomposes the single stop concern into two events:
- `on_user_turn_inference_triggered` fires when a stop strategy has
  enough signal to start LLM inference. The aggregator pushes the
  context here, kicking off the LLM call.
- `on_user_turn_stopped` fires only when the user turn is semantically
  final. Built-in strategies fire both events at the same call site,
  preserving today's behavior for the common case.

Adds `LLMTurnCompletionUserTurnStopStrategy`, which gates
finalization on a `UserTurnCompletedFrame` (a fieldless system frame
emitted by any component judging turn completeness — currently the
`UserTurnCompletionLLMServiceMixin` on `✓`).

Adds `deferred(strategy)` / `DeferredUserTurnStopStrategy`, a thin
wrapper that forwards an inner strategy's events except
`on_user_turn_stopped`. Use this to install a stop strategy as an
inference trigger only, leaving finalization to a peer (e.g. the LLM
completion strategy).

Adds `llm_completion_user_turn_stop_strategies()` for the common
case:

    UserTurnStrategies(
        stop=llm_completion_user_turn_stop_strategies(),
    )

Deprecates `LLMUserAggregatorParams.filter_incomplete_user_turns`.
The aggregator emits a `DeprecationWarning`, wraps existing stop
strategies with `deferred(...)`, and appends
`LLMTurnCompletionUserTurnStopStrategy` automatically.
